NEW PAYMENT METHODS
The Town of
Aberdeen's Water Department accepts Visa, Discover and Mastercard. This payment method is being accepted
for all parks and recreation fees, planning and
zoning fees, yard sale fees, parking tickets,
privilege licenses, new service applications and water bills.
The Water Department is open Monday
thru Friday, 8:00 a.m. - 5:00 p.m.
BANK DRAFT
The Water
Department offers and encourages bank draft for
utility payments. This payment option requires
the customer to sign up on bank draft (ACH
Withdrawal) by submitting a voided check and
a signed copy of a release for the funds to be
withdrawn for. The utility payment is drafted from the
customer's bank account on or around the 10th day of the
billing month. This method is a wonderful option
for those who travel often or just need one less
worry about getting their payment in on time.
Please remember
when signing up for bank draft, your account has to
be pre-noted through your bank with a 00.00 charge
one billing cycle prior to your account actually
being drafted. We recommend you plan for this.
Check your bank account to confirm the pre-note
amount is 00.00. When you receive your water bill
statement after the pre-note, your water bill
statement will state “Your account will be drafted…”
at this point you know all your information has
cleared and you’re successfully set up for bank
draft (ACH Withdrawal). If you have any questions,
please call the Water Department at 944-7799.

BILLS RECEIVED THROUGH THE MAIL
When mailing your
bill or dropping it in the night deposit,
PLEASE
write your
account number on your check. This insures that the
payment is posted to the correct account. The Water
Department also requests that customers do not tape
or staple their bill stubs to their check.
YARD SALE PERMITS
Yard sale permits can be
obtained at the Water Department. Each Town of
Aberdeen resident is allowed two yard sales per year
and must fill out a yard sale permit form and pay a $5.00 fee.
